Emma's family has a strong association with the sport of gymnastics, as her uncle is Peter Vidmar, the highest scoring American gymnast in Olympic history.  As captain of the US team at the '84 Olympics Peter led his team to America's first team gold metal for gymnastics and individually won silver for All-Around.  He is still active in gymnastics today and serves as Chairman of the Board of USA Gymnastics.
